Description: The Iowa Motor Truck Association was formed in 1942 after a group of motor carriers felt that Iowa’s trucking industry needed a voice at the State Capitol. The association not only is the recognized voice of trucking, it is also a valued business partner to its members through the variety of membership benefits that are offered by the association. Currently, the Iowa Motor Truck Association has over 700 member companies and continues to strengthen its foundation by enrolling additional members.
